Best Hairstyles for Brisbane Race Season 2026

Hair Trends
May 19, 2026

The Best Hairstyles for Brisbane Race Season 2026 are polished, elegant and designed to last through a full day at the track. From sleek low buns to soft romantic waves, Brisbane race day hair is all about pairing beautiful styling with practical wearability for our warm, sunny climate.

Brisbane Race Season is one of the most stylish events on the local calendar, especially at Brisbane Racing Club events across Eagle Farm and Doomben. Whether you are attending Derby Day, Oaks Day, Stradbroke Day or another major race day, your hairstyle should work with your outfit, fascinator and the overall racewear dress code.

Below are the Best Hairstyles for Brisbane Race Season 2026 to inspire your next race day look.

1. Sleek low buns for classic racewear

A sleek low bun is one of the most timeless race day hairstyles. It is elegant, secure and perfect for Brisbane’s subtropical weather. This style keeps the hair smooth and controlled while allowing your fascinator or hat to sit beautifully.

For Brisbane Race Club styling, this look works well with pillbox hats, structured headbands, wide-brim hats and sculptural fascinators. Ask your stylist for a clean centre part, polished shine and a neat bun placed at the nape of the neck.

This is one of the Best Hairstyles for Brisbane Race Season 2026 if you want a refined, classic look that photographs beautifully.

2. Sculptural updos for Derby Day drama

Sculptural updos are set to be a major hair trend for Brisbane Race Season 2026. Think glossy French twists, coiled chignons, rolled buns and smooth architectural shapes.

This style is especially suited to Derby Day, where black and white racewear creates the perfect opportunity for a bold, high-fashion hairstyle. A sculptural updo works beautifully with monochrome millinery, pearl earrings and structured tailoring.

For best results, keep the finish smooth, glossy and intentional. This hairstyle should look polished rather than messy, with enough hold to last from arrival to the final race.

3. Romantic waves for Oaks Day

Soft romantic waves are ideal for Oaks Day and feminine racewear looks. This hairstyle feels glamorous without looking too formal, making it perfect for floral dresses, soft pastels, maroon accents and delicate fascinators.

For Brisbane’s climate, the key is creating waves that are glossy, soft and long-lasting. Avoid overly stiff curls. Instead, choose brushed-out waves with a smooth finish and plenty of movement.

Romantic waves are one of the Best Hairstyles for Brisbane Race Season 2026 because they suit many hair lengths, face shapes and outfit styles.

4. Braided ponytails for a modern race day edge

A sleek braided ponytail is a modern option for racegoers who want something stylish, secure and fashion-forward. This look is ideal for Brisbane race days because it keeps the hair controlled while still feeling fresh and current.

A high braided ponytail creates drama, while a low braided ponytail feels elegant and refined. Both styles work well with hats, headbands and minimal fascinators because the crown stays smooth.

This is a great choice if you want a hairstyle that feels polished but not traditional.

5. Hair accessories, bows and headbands

Hair accessories will continue to be popular for Brisbane Race Season 2026. Bows, padded headbands, pearl clips, crystal barrettes and ribbon details can instantly elevate a simple hairstyle.

For race day, the accessory should complement your millinery and outfit rather than compete with them. A velvet bow works beautifully with soft waves, while a pearl barrette can add detail to a low bun or half-up style.

If your outfit is simple, a statement hair accessory can make your entire look feel more styled and complete.

6. Short hair, bobs and pixies

Short hair can look incredibly chic for race season. Glossy bobs, sharp cuts and refined pixies pair beautifully with structured headbands, small fascinators and statement earrings.

For a bob, try a smooth tucked-behind-the-ear finish, a soft bend through the ends or a sleek side part. For pixie cuts, add shine, texture and a bold accessory.

Short hair is one of the Best Hairstyles for Brisbane Race Season 2026 for anyone wanting a fresh, modern and low-maintenance race day look.

Final tip: match your hairstyle to the dress code

The best race day hairstyle should suit your outfit, headpiece and the Brisbane weather. It should feel secure, polished and comfortable enough to wear all day.

Whether you choose a sleek bun, sculptural updo, romantic waves, braided ponytail, statement bow or glossy bob, the Best Hairstyles for Brisbane Race Season 2026 are all about confidence, shine and beautiful race day styling.
